The French Language Syllabus under NEP 2020
The National Education Policy (NEP) 2020 marks a transformative shift in the Indian educational landscape. By emphasizing multilingualism and global cultural exposure, the policy has paved the way for a more robust integration of foreign languages, including French, into the academic curriculum. The 2021-22 academic cycle served as a critical implementation phase for aligning existing pedagogical frameworks with the NEPs vision of holistic, skill-based, and experiential learning.
Educational Philosophy and Objectives
Under the NEP 2020 framework, the study of French is no longer viewed merely as an elective subject but as a tool for cognitive development and intercultural competence. The syllabus for the 2021-22 period focused on:
- Communicative Proficiency: Moving away from rote memorization of grammar rules toward functional fluency.
- Cultural Integration: Understanding the Francophone world to foster empathy and global citizenship.
- Interdisciplinary Approach: Connecting French language acquisition with history, art, and sociology.
- Digital Literacy: Leveraging technological tools for language labs and immersive virtual experiences.
Key Components of the Syllabus
The 2021-22 curriculum was structured around four primary pillars to ensure a balanced development of linguistic competencies:
- Reading Comprehension: Focus on diverse texts ranging from contemporary blogs to classical literature.
- Creative Writing: Encouraging learners to articulate thoughts through essays, creative storytelling, and formal correspondence.
- Grammar in Context: Rather than isolating verb conjugations, grammar was taught through functional application and active usage.
- Oral Expression: A significant increase in weightage for speaking skills, including debates, presentations, and conversational simulations.
Pedagogical Shifts
The NEP 2020 mandates a shift from summative assessment (exams) to formative assessment (continuous learning). For French students, this meant:
- Project-Based Learning: Students were encouraged to create portfolios, video essays, or cultural research projects that showcased their command of the language in real-world scenarios.
- Flexible Learning Paths: The syllabus design allowed schools to adapt content based on the student's proficiency levels rather than a rigid "one size fits all" approach.
- Integration of AI and Language Tools: Teachers were encouraged to use interactive platforms to supplement textbook learning, making the language more accessible to students in both urban and semi-urban settings.
Impact on Skill Development
The inclusion of French under the NEP guidelines has significantly enhanced the "Global Readiness" of Indian students. By the end of the 2021-22 academic year, the syllabus aimed to ensure that students were not only able to clear standardized exams (such as DELF/DALF benchmarks) but were also equipped to navigate professional and academic environments where French is a working language. The emphasis on "Critical Thinking" meant that students were regularly asked to analyze news, social trends, and cultural narratives from France and other Francophone nations, thereby broadening their intellectual horizons.
Conclusion
The French language syllabus during the 2021-22 implementation of NEP 2020 represented a departure from traditional colonial-era language teaching methods. By prioritizing communicative effectiveness and cultural appreciation, the policy has successfully positioned French as a vital bridge between India and the global community. As schools continue to refine these practices, the focus remains on transforming the classroom into a space where language is a vibrant, living tool for connection.
